beep
bip

Definition of beep - Reverso English Dictionary

Noun

1.
signalshort high-pitched sound typically used as a signal
  • The beep of the microwave indicated the food was ready..
signal tone
2.
communicationDatedUSmessage sent to a pagerDatedUS
  • He received a beep from his boss.
alert notification signal

Verb

1.
sound emissionintr.emit a short high soundintr.
  • The device will beep once it's ready..
chirp honk
2.
communicationtr.DatedUScontact someone using a pagertr.DatedUS
  • She beeped him to call back.
alert page signal
3.
censorshiptr.TECH.mask offensive words with short electronic tonestr.TECH.
  • They beeped the swear words on TV.
bleep censor
